The Well-Ordered Family is a classic work by the Puritan author Isaac Ambrose (1604-1664). Like many works from this era of Christian history, The Well-Ordered Family is packed full of practical biblical principles waiting to be applied to every Christian household. However, the distance between our modern day and these types of works makes them difficult to read and so neglected by today's reader. This annotated version has been precisely edited to bring the depth of its content back to today's families. Through slight editing of the original text spelling and grammar with the additional of footnotes, anyone desiring to become a better father, mother, husband and wife can enjoy and benefit from this Puritan classic. Included in this edition is an in-depth biography of Isaac Ambrose so that you can get to know one of the early Puritans of England.
Autorenporträt
Isaac Ambrose (1604-1663), was a Reformed, Presbyterian puritan divine whose works were held in high esteem. C. Matthew McMahon, Ph.D., Th.D., is a Reformed theologian, and pastor of Grace Chapel in Crossville, TN. He is the founder and chairman of A Puritan's Mind, the largest Reformed website on the internet for students of the Bible concerning Reformed Theology, the Puritans and Covenant Theology. He is the founder of Puritan Publications which publishes rare Reformed and Puritan works from the 17th century, specializing in the Westminster Assembly. He is also a managing partner at Reformed.org, and the Center for Reformed Theology and Apologetics.
